Plot of land for sale near Albena

 

You may take advantage of this attractive offer for a building plot of 500 sq m located just a few kilometers away from the sea! The property is located in a beautiful quiet village near the sea resorts of Albena, Kranevo and Golden Sands. The distance to Albena is some 4 km and a half and reaching the International Airport of Varna takes no more than 20 minutes by car. The settlement where the property is has about 200 permanent residents. However it has become very popular and preferable place for investments. For the last three years many new houses and complexes have been built. The village boasts with its charming nature and fresh air. It is right next to a big forest and in close vicinity of the so called reserve of Baltata. Thanks to its location on a big hill right above Albena the village offers beautiful sea and forest view.

We offer you to make a good investment buying a property in that fascinating place. The plot we offer is perfect for a holiday house. According to the regulation indexes of the area you could have up to 60 % of the land built up. The building could be max 3 storey, up to 10 m high. Water and electricity are available in the neighbouring properties.
